While MC50 performed select European dates over the summer, Faith No More Followers reports that the MC50 tour starts this week on September 9th in Florida, however Wayne Kramer, Faith No More bassist Bill Gould, Soundgarden guitarist Kim Thayil, Fugazi drummer Brendan Canty, and Zen Guerrilla frontman Marcus Durant performed a warm-up show on Monday night at Swing House Studios in LA to a lucky few. This was the debut performance for the new lineup featuring Gould, who is replacing dUg Pinnick on bass. Matt Cameron previously played with MC50, and is expected to pop up at some shows.
